About Eleuteriusz
Stemming from ancient Greek roots, Eleuteriusz carries the profound meaning of "free" or "the liberator." This name was bestowed upon the Greek god Dionysus, acknowledging his power to liberate individuals through the transformative experience of ecstasy and intoxication.
In the annals of Christianity, the name Eleuteriusz holds significant reverence. Pope Saint Eleuterus, also known as Eleutherius, served as Bishop of Rome from 174 to 189. Born in Nicopolis, Epirus, this saint's name has been embraced by numerous saints throughout Europe, earning recognition within both the Catholic and Orthodox Churches.
